  •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Engineering or a related technical discipline.
  • Minimum 5 years of project management experience, including at least 3 years in the pharmaceutical industry.
  • Proven success managing mid-to-large scale design projects with total installed cost (TIC) ranging from $20M to $300M.
  • Strong familiarity with GMP, project lifecycle methodologies, and design documentation standards.
